CHEP helps move more goods to more people, in more places than any other organization on earth via our 300 million pallets, crates and containers. We employ 11,000 people and operate in more than 55 countries. Through our pioneering and sustainable share-and-reuse business model, the world’s biggest brands trust us to help them transport their goods more efficiently, safely and with less environmental impact.

Job Description
CHEP Australia is seeking a detail-oriented and results-driven Manager of Pricing, Billing, and Master Data to step into a 6-month Fixed-Term Contract based at Macquarie Park, Sydney (Hybrid work arrangement).
This role is critical in ensuring the seamless execution of pricing, invoicing, and master data processes across the APAC region, supporting our Finance, Sales, and IT teams.
You’ll collaborate with cross-functional stakeholders, lead process improvements, and oversee key business outputs while working closely with automation teams to identify and implement innovative solutions.
Your Key Responsibilities- Strategic Oversight: Oversee and continuously improve processes related to pricing, invoicing, and master data while aligning with business objectives.- Team Management: Lead and audit the Master Data team in India to maintain high standards of data integrity.- Operational Excellence: Design, develop, and enforce standard operating procedures for all Master Data activities.-
- Collaboration: Partner with global IT teams, sales, and finance teams to ensure timely and accurate regional invoicing.- Innovation: Research and implement new technologies, including RPA, to enhance business efficiency.- Project Leadership: Contribute to business projects, including system testing, impact assessment, and user acceptance testing.
About You
You’re a proactive leader with strong technical and interpersonal skills. You thrive in a dynamic environment and have a passion for solving complex problems through collaboration and innovation.
Qualifications & Experience:
- Degree in Finance, Commerce, Information Systems, or a related field.- General IT experience, with expertise in SAP and Salesforce highly desirable.- Proven track record of managing pricing, invoicing, and master data in a business environment.- Experience in a global, multicultural organization is a plus.
Key Skills:
- Exceptional verbal and written communication skills, confident in managing key stakeholders at senior levels.- Strong analytical and problem-solving abilities.- Attention to detail with excellent time management.- Technical proficiency: Hands-on experience with ERP systems, database management tools, and automation solutions, with certifications being a bonus.- Creativity and strategic thinking to implement innovative solutions.- Proactive leadership and Process Improvement mindset.
